喝杯下午茶,聊IS-IS.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
喝杯下午茶,聊IS-IS

喝杯下午茶,聊聊IS-IS 我想对于一个网络来说,最核心的技术应该就是路由技术,因为这是网络所需要解决的最最主要的问题。近些日子,IS-IS路由技术在中国国内日渐盛行起来,在大型网络中,IS-IS是要优于OSPF的。一些前人大侠经常习惯在讲解IS-IS时拿它和OSPF作比较,这样的目的是方便大家能够更快的理解。我个人不赞成这种方法,因为我个人的亲身经历告诉我这样学习东西实在是很费劲的一件事:这就像是拿汉语去标识英语单词的发音,当我的OSPF还不是很精熟的时候,这个时候拿它映射IS-IS无疑是雪上加霜——这样会导致概念的混淆——本身OSPF和IS-IS中的一些概念虽然相似但是却是有差别的。所以,当你想学习IS-IS的时候,干脆忘掉OSPF吧。 已经废话了一堆了,下面就切入正题吧。 在你真正的学习IS-IS之前,你要问一下自己,自己对路由协议了解多少呢?如果你全不了解,那还是建议你去看看路由协议的基本知识,这样你在遇到IS-IS或OSPF等协议时才能真正看得懂。你要知道,任何路由协议的本质都是相同的,只不过是实现的方式不同而已,因此才会存在诸多的区别。 在学习IS-IS的时候可能最不理解的就是它既然不是TCP/IP协议的东西,为什么还能工作在TCP/IP模型之中呢?说实话,我到现在也不是十分的清楚(我是指OSI那一套寻址方式,当然,应该和IP差不多的),不过你要注意,大侠们在给你传授IS-IS时一定不会忘记说这样一句话:IS-IS协议是直接跑在链路层上的。 我这里想斗胆讲一下OSI的地址模式(网络层),在IS-IS的胶片中,我们知道,如果要使IS-IS工作,那么一个NET地址是不可或缺的,一个NET实际上是一个特殊的NSAP(Network Service Access Point)这个东东相当于TCP/IP里的IP地址,其实如果你仔细的观察一下NSAP地址的话,你就会发现,它和IP地址是一样的,只不过比IP地址更加具体。首先它的第一部分是AS名,然后就是区域名紧随其后,接着是主机ID,最后是接口号,只有最后这一点不同,IP里是没有接口号的(那个端口号和这个应该不是一个概念),因为在一个IP网络中,我们直接就为接口配置一个IP地址了。所以,对于一个OSI地址它一样可以像IP地址一样行使寻址的职务。那么一个OSI的地址是如何在IP的环境中跑起来的呢?你一定会问我这个问题,当然了,我也曾经为了这个问题而连续失眠1个小时!你忘了那些大侠们常常挂在嘴边的一句话么?IS-IS是跑在链路层的协议。所以说啊,它的传载根本就不经过TCP/IP协议栈!它当然跑得起来了! 你可以看看截发包工具NetWizard中的packet build的各个报文结构,你会发现,IS-IS的报文是没有IP的组播地址的,原因很简单,因为它不是基于IP/TCP模式构造的。曾经有人向IETF提出draft将IS-IS协议报文封装在IP中,但是对于发展和应用到现在的IS-IS来说这实际上并不是一个好的想法。 在这里我引用RFC 1195中的一段文字: The IP address structure allows networks to be partitioned into subnets, and allows subnets to be recursively subdivided into smaller subnets. However, it is undesirable to require any specific relationship between IP subnet addresses and IS-IS areas. For example, in many cases, the dual routers may be installed into existing environments, which already have assigned IP and/or OSI addresses. In addition, even if IP addresses are not already pre-assigned, the address limitations of IP constrain what addresses may be assigned. We therefore will not require any specific relationship between IP addresses and the area structure. The IP addresses can be assigned compl

文档评论(0)

feng1960808 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档